Are people in Pacheco older or younger than people in Houston?
- The Median Age in Pacheco is 8.0 years older than in Houston.

Are housing costs cheaper in Pacheco or Houston?
- Pacheco housing costs are 13.8% less expensive than Houston hous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Pacheco or Houston?
- The average commute for residents of Pacheco is 0.2 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Houston.
